Understanding the Community
As a professional educator, it is important to understand the community that surrounds our school. Students and teachers can greatly benefit from the services provided by the community. It is part of our job as a teacher to know what kind of services are available in our community and to reach out to these businesses and organizations.
Community Outreach Programs, School-Community Partnerships, and Community Liaisons are great ways to get the community involved in the school. There are many people of expertise that exists in the community. Many schools fail to use these extremely valuable resources. Research the community that your school is in to determine what services are available to help the students' reach their highest potential. Schools must realize that in order to receive, they must give. Schools can give back to the community by holding Family Fun Nights, Talent Shows, food drives, etc.
